As someone who's played it:
-The new combat is very fun, albeit being able to block anything is slightly broken in your favor (I played on Nightmare)
-Karja is by far the best of Adol's allies not named Dogi. Focusing on just one other party member instead of a squad really helps flesh her story out
-A 100% (all trophies, Switch version has trophies built in) took me about 80 hours, but I read all NPC dialogue too and I'm slower at reading Japanese, so it's probably more like 50-60 hours depending on if you do that or not
-Soundtrack is great all around, honestly Boss Theme 4 is prob my favorite standard boss theme from all Ys games
-Ship gameplay is ass cheeks
-The graphics are... not the best
-It's Ys so the story isn't anything remarkable, hits Falcom's usual beats and character tropes/moments
I personally had a lot of fun with it, but there are some rough edges.
